rocketPy

View on PyPIReverse Dependencies (2)

1.6.1 rocketpy-1.6.1-py3-none-any.whl

Wheel Details

Project: rocketPy
Version: 1.6.1
Filename: rocketpy-1.6.1-py3-none-any.whl
Download: [link]
Size: 338732
MD5: df83401063671a71a0ef1076e63b27bf
SHA256: 85c8d098bd24f8dcc07f44d240218b3483496547afcea7dd24ce6544b85b7b28
Uploaded: 2024-10-09 19:20:32 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: rocketpy
Version: 1.6.1
Summary: Advanced 6-DOF trajectory simulation for High-Power Rocketry.
Author-Email: Giovani Hidalgo Ceotto <ghceotto[at]gmail.com>
Project-Url: homepage, https://rocketpy.org/
Project-Url: documentation, https://docs.rocketpy.org/
Project-Url: repository, https://github.com/RocketPy-Team/RocketPy
Classifier: Programming Language :: Python :: 3
Classifier: License :: OSI Approved :: MIT License
Classifier: Operating System :: OS Independent
Requires-Python: >=3.9
Requires-Dist: numpy (>=1.13)
Requires-Dist: scipy (>=1.0)
Requires-Dist: matplotlib (>=3.0)
Requires-Dist: netCDF4 (>=1.6.4)
Requires-Dist: requests
Requires-Dist: pytz
Requires-Dist: simplekml
Requires-Dist: rocketpy[env-analysis]; extra == "all"
Requires-Dist: rocketpy[monte-carlo]; extra == "all"
Requires-Dist: windrose (>=1.6.8); extra == "env-analysis"
Requires-Dist: timezonefinder; extra == "env-analysis"
Requires-Dist: jsonpickle; extra == "env-analysis"
Requires-Dist: ipython; extra == "env-analysis"
Requires-Dist: ipywidgets (>=7.6.3); extra == "env-analysis"
Requires-Dist: imageio; extra == "monte-carlo"
Requires-Dist: statsmodels; extra == "monte-carlo"
Requires-Dist: prettytable; extra == "monte-carlo"
Requires-Dist: pytest; extra == "tests"
Requires-Dist: pytest-coverage; extra == "tests"
Requires-Dist: black[jupyter]; extra == "tests"
Requires-Dist: flake8-black; extra == "tests"
Requires-Dist: flake8-pyproject; extra == "tests"
Requires-Dist: pandas; extra == "tests"
Requires-Dist: numericalunits (==1.25); extra == "tests"
Requires-Dist: pylint; extra == "tests"
Requires-Dist: isort; extra == "tests"
Provides-Extra: all
Provides-Extra: env-analysis
Provides-Extra: monte-carlo
Provides-Extra: tests
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 16150 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(75.1.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
rocketpy/__init__.py sha256=wumZVRA5yReprX4_QPMBf6-zY_YXitmop9gAzJUeAH0 1206
rocketpy/_encoders.py sha256=D3UVeiRPBaicITd2aZ5pYjA5K3Uf1P3QjNbz3PEvPt8 1147
rocketpy/tools.py sha256=74rmuh-uO_VhbmdpFYCvrGhzqczo6EECELBOxnteTt4 37279
rocketpy/units.py sha256=L9XnjP5UabBX8NrzxaL1GyA2XxcPRB51lsIhonOtiQ8 4828
rocketpy/utilities.py sha256=Bypb3g41non1nP-ebGJdlmx07rzYy2wdcKHfueubc9A 22750
rocketpy/control/__init__.py sha256=v8hpjpzB4NXd92PFLf6CENPFH70tYoIzEZSShVVzlAU 36
rocketpy/control/controller.py sha256=M6SC_I_gBvIvTwxEB6WcABjW25-xybUxEdZGOz_P8FM 8292
rocketpy/environment/__init__.py sha256=BJUAOmeqDzqxtfPyCVBkKPg9ymWD4RRh2TxMBTQKM_A 353
rocketpy/environment/environment.py sha256=ErFJY-b8tk6_endVh9z0jy8p9RUv2yefev4kzzj2QFw 115766
rocketpy/environment/environment_analysis.py sha256=MWwwK0IY-SXcwg0DgVXE_wBQ1ZRXWnI2YEdCTb_DGqw 105843
rocketpy/environment/fetchers.py sha256=QCPOvtbS1ANeDfmfke_ilFtITQ8pgMmaKgd4Ae6f-R8 13639
rocketpy/environment/tools.py sha256=m9geLz3hLKH38ztS-Srcr4O1wobFm0W_2FG0HTqlqSU 18106
rocketpy/environment/weather_model_mapping.py sha256=-YvX5bi_zkGTNFe64bov2LD6r2Ot_blORMZxOE0WMcg 3590
rocketpy/mathutils/__init__.py sha256=JaW6QLdvWLAG7aP4fQvfCJaLTl4ZuyTmVCghEzieX5U 154
rocketpy/mathutils/function.py sha256=8eEFIPZtflsEiAO9NJ0BE_RajowZNBOvMtgf4HyZR5I 142474
rocketpy/mathutils/vector_matrix.py sha256=JUPYcJpUv9CE8uP3B6eZB3TS3xewTo9GT0XRFHPT3bY 31281
rocketpy/motors/__init__.py sha256=kd-Y36UwbuzPh6raKDMAmuiYxmFRKFDoRADYj43LBEY 379
rocketpy/motors/fluid.py sha256=OJCZA5pLtrdpdplli3mHdBPeGBXVdCu8L4-rB_w2HVE 1362
rocketpy/motors/hybrid_motor.py sha256=Su7-2VgViAr2y1GVkOSQGcqCZUkA1vT2TTdpLkbkvvI 25938
rocketpy/motors/liquid_motor.py sha256=rLediWmnzARfbPOmJl7ThBG0O7xpWxrWcMuLtj4a9ZQ 19974
rocketpy/motors/motor.py sha256=kL4Rr05HGQcwJ9JmBkFxqyA_Uzk1BcIOKYfY-W_N9TM 61659
rocketpy/motors/solid_motor.py sha256=3pICqyPqyKI3aLXEHWOewZHKTpUrhwPQ-Cbsie58MzI 29694
rocketpy/motors/tank.py sha256=JxIhP5m9NVL2P0mXg1WcNn4K-gYC54P1UVch2S4IEnM 52974
rocketpy/motors/tank_geometry.py sha256=AqEazw5wGroAUb7FnMkaMktJOyghVK35GKLLVWFQYn4 15018
rocketpy/plots/__init__.py sha256=LEyTcfek-PSU9T_bMIqVw1j4JWSLzeriGKIErZh0Wks 45
rocketpy/plots/aero_surface_plots.py sha256=3Mv92Y1e0R3nLM7t6nDlrje03tBJscckiTdrQD5xwPM 15060
rocketpy/plots/environment_analysis_plots.py sha256=nM8D7UQB6Q3BPuAw76RMYya8YpvmUwzbDLPWn0_DfBk 65175
rocketpy/plots/environment_plots.py sha256=nkBVmM2bHQdHRI8PWf6lrhXU522FCzxRx6PGMxjjezk 11364
rocketpy/plots/flight_plots.py sha256=92k8oQyogO9WAM7828yOQ75TNKr4qLaqJfUG1sN2c3I 29669
rocketpy/plots/fluid_plots.py sha256=ZB9V85QNh0Vznb0KIUZ4a5qHfwVUYBex9nR5Jk0UQeE 663
rocketpy/plots/hybrid_motor_plots.py sha256=EuD4woEQslwAYS9sqh3S_1KNk9ZAOC-zpqZatYdrFi4 5543
rocketpy/plots/liquid_motor_plots.py sha256=vopPyGR5eULbcgwxeHuqdhZWT-lXa9yo_J8I5mr1mwo 1840
rocketpy/plots/monte_carlo_plots.py sha256=0YZ55xyGmBMSyjyk0V2VHYrDnb8Xs3bcSdCNdvjBJBk 5196
rocketpy/plots/motor_plots.py sha256=P2TzYu6LZS95v5RB1ReR6RG0eeykX-GtPyeZ6lEJy18 17603
rocketpy/plots/rocket_plots.py sha256=JRluq0RJnXqSdpx-tmKaYd6goXLeDCOGlxTNQpM_LiU 23789
rocketpy/plots/sensitivity_plots.py sha256=pZP1KFBtLsDn9v0jZZ7k20JmkC1YWzd1v6XS6LsmFSA 2511
rocketpy/plots/solid_motor_plots.py sha256=vMO2Bi0NkWRskFEReCHpliP9ryHSmEvfJ2Nhl4jgR-4 5242
rocketpy/plots/tank_geometry_plots.py sha256=uqv83H9ooyicKW77ZhvXcrx8cS9JyLH_hI2DXfhQ6HA 1121
rocketpy/plots/tank_plots.py sha256=zP_Okobcq3BoT64FzAlTKocVXK4az5H9uNDYcmEIvD4 2755
rocketpy/plots/compare/__init__.py sha256=rhKMrZ3ejqQSngg1H4e71Wh5r-ceapqXAUE9NrULNhw 73
rocketpy/plots/compare/compare.py sha256=P4-mddiV4dBrBiN1w50GzKkm1XMrW5Psb_Eudp9Q034 6451
rocketpy/plots/compare/compare_flights.py sha256=wFtYEl8OoVqmNb2DNHSvY1XHDStwU8SOdRA0UStxuRs 55951
rocketpy/prints/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
rocketpy/prints/aero_surface_prints.py sha256=oqisJssCm9OtyoSNOVqtrxHUxieITPJHqqH5f2PT73U 8519
rocketpy/prints/compare_prints.py sha256=9MuRgKanP99ppo6iDdjYWKDSP14xaFyGL9Tz0dO3OJI 67
rocketpy/prints/controller_prints.py sha256=5tSoKMXlARM5Z6qeda-1NUYmW8g1UwYHy44gFAWGeaw 1873
rocketpy/prints/environment_analysis_prints.py sha256=69t5INZrDwP61yB3OvCt-Yn73CceJn0Uow097ArV9Vo 7929
rocketpy/prints/environment_prints.py sha256=qsAjc4YuT3-JGZOkojddJ5zVqTaWRCyjPd5qOpHE570 6849
rocketpy/prints/flight_prints.py sha256=lH8iBOPDKG4fqsUooaQQGFdxG3oYxrVk2SPIkhZaDA8 15639
rocketpy/prints/fluid_prints.py sha256=YMj1hTueQcfNDtXTAaGe3LVWqkFbeWpHhy0WtBrpPZ0 621
rocketpy/prints/hybrid_motor_prints.py sha256=8qRhZULACu1GZ6Z47Unicj58mTEPTynLyT_OU9CDuXw 3159
rocketpy/prints/liquid_motor_prints.py sha256=0ZxJdcyuluwedMRUJSjEQz4iOQmZgylG1Sbta_AiRaI 1865
rocketpy/prints/monte_carlo_prints.py sha256=VDfytqOhDgtL-WCzBXftke6JIG4J4LsxU4ii6VnrnfM 879
rocketpy/prints/motor_prints.py sha256=Z4TDrMZmjSBIuEjlVa73FWg1LURAOYzUZboFxIfm1Ls 1462
rocketpy/prints/parachute_prints.py sha256=Iua88D0O_vGwVXWor8cgpJs2HqE9IULaP3Cp0Hzb68g 1892
rocketpy/prints/rocket_prints.py sha256=mGPLJMVbatZc1af1SbA5xfJpKsheUWvnX21SNQWivqQ 5243
rocketpy/prints/sensitivity_prints.py sha256=Q6t6eA8DkhFcqcpOShymrImPuGsxqFKNxZIyMmuuNcw 4256
rocketpy/prints/sensors_prints.py sha256=cO4vsaXmH34YwsDPbt4HYcyw2XOqkpsOXZyemPRpG6Y 4027
rocketpy/prints/solid_motor_prints.py sha256=MNbXZW6u3umBDwFbSla0k_LkB_ijyq43w5BPfK8FORc 2763
rocketpy/prints/tank_geometry_prints.py sha256=qO6QuzfKI72r60VXkROm9PQM5eFYitf2gjfh78sj03g 1236
rocketpy/prints/tank_prints.py sha256=YJdAf5W8QAD1_c8GKFkB8vHZ9Isl9tFWtb_bz8yAKCQ 607
rocketpy/rocket/__init__.py sha256=-YuCtslN138CmD6PSItPU9U2euD5j1_3gsT-tkqU1xk 425
rocketpy/rocket/components.py sha256=olbyO03F53w4tA5fZlOgr_tkt84fjgZzE9r0DdjzDp4 5892
rocketpy/rocket/parachute.py sha256=osdV4DTFzN4xheoqLsOrTUi8earOAutEwckpb4MF_Hk 10484
rocketpy/rocket/rocket.py sha256=epwGAAlsWpsUYvjNSjHa5hdOpQpkGdJ6jXkgHgLCJJA 78210
rocketpy/rocket/aero_surface/__init__.py sha256=eUo0lxwGGy5CoQXfowk_nWC9uw_lU0Y1I1xbIj0TrNk 581
rocketpy/rocket/aero_surface/aero_surface.py sha256=kMuxYGQlJoR4KyPnlZ21o-XQVvA4MQijQDxFIn-L06E 4479
rocketpy/rocket/aero_surface/air_brakes.py sha256=nNhGThnIRGui_usjmOb0q7B9Z01PNN68lcC75hRdLWk 8057
rocketpy/rocket/aero_surface/generic_surface.py sha256=lRfOdUBTbU1SQrvah9DP2oE9_l_NkUShRJcWW5ADTPU 16012
rocketpy/rocket/aero_surface/linear_generic_surface.py sha256=0xaEqE6lKid3VhauGGn5CTXQURZTsF5G0QzhzdkfA8Q 16005
rocketpy/rocket/aero_surface/nose_cone.py sha256=igypeOMDJxdl4itwzM4CRYCM_74BwhCXlCh3e6CKt4o 19711
rocketpy/rocket/aero_surface/rail_buttons.py sha256=9TTQ2y6nt_Q--jdGIcFPBLR28dGJjPguVKG05CPUWWI 3607
rocketpy/rocket/aero_surface/tail.py sha256=5wUo5kagQ7NqSRsghtsARbhOxJ_J5fbeUMi-4favGXs 6796
rocketpy/rocket/aero_surface/fins/__init__.py sha256=4MjkaLQe-kiVBwbj3O8ACo7b78ggFzYlOnROeBkKMCc 286
rocketpy/rocket/aero_surface/fins/elliptical_fins.py sha256=TVoLKnTI5glfECylicoBA6xTxrLuiq9G8FQgrtbnEG4 12682
rocketpy/rocket/aero_surface/fins/fins.py sha256=K3d9SVgjJ0973seHF1IeRGqp6vFDm3SaZyDgM7fcmWE 14940
rocketpy/rocket/aero_surface/fins/free_form_fins.py sha256=nu_SXgjLkWW6daJZsjec8WBkNI-dLI5ktPi0agDTN3I 14468
rocketpy/rocket/aero_surface/fins/trapezoidal_fins.py sha256=Y74Jo2g_FYOtEK0mU_-l83oOT39y2EPjsYr6G1lk3ko 13402
rocketpy/sensitivity/__init__.py sha256=kEwB2ZBITrMSNmxoe-urU_Oz_5tPclhtrGlIrgHiGuA 48
rocketpy/sensitivity/sensitivity_model.py sha256=LuUqO07h5bGu0CVJ3vR3euX3taboNWzhnpKfa1WKNaA 13645
rocketpy/sensors/__init__.py sha256=-hAYRuZLH9Zp5gAG-0kfVcrUbXBK-xvJahiTi7nQr0o 204
rocketpy/sensors/accelerometer.py sha256=kQ1crs6lJ_N8PnD_Tsq06TaU503_tPlPKXINErfv7Jg 11871
rocketpy/sensors/barometer.py sha256=9KvrJ2I4o1vYX8MZQsTGMAV0Wfi8vtH10SyogWy2U-g 7261
rocketpy/sensors/gnss_receiver.py sha256=Wfk-6_o1CcCbFO4LZxV6DmsuT58x1t4Rr2Fk3Yowtoc 4286
rocketpy/sensors/gyroscope.py sha256=PS_RW4eksA1_qNgC6riY9stvN__AEyn7gPFDYmoOhHU 12959
rocketpy/sensors/sensor.py sha256=kvsJ3-oorshp5viuKjfY2kc_3YDXtkdTcUdohWZWWA0 31351
rocketpy/simulation/__init__.py sha256=0_ZQM8AgEzwEpjJmWKVFMwUBVTri3uaSBZFISooE95I 116
rocketpy/simulation/flight.py sha256=gOuh6nSxm8z1YB4w_6Ym83BJ1NZ4l5fj4FosjUl8tzI 159878
rocketpy/simulation/flight_data_importer.py sha256=IExE9rqV088VSgmkOwNZeSq4qwLLC20UGAen040NCUk 13632
rocketpy/simulation/monte_carlo.py sha256=9N5ejAQS3PvIZZGbnjbcXI6iETWGIJZoC9MlkEBjq6c 29447
rocketpy/stochastic/__init__.py sha256=i-3x19RMbIVfV5IWbcM_VpCfhiajw8XSBd1nOvrfBTE 816
rocketpy/stochastic/stochastic_aero_surfaces.py sha256=Ba1w65glmYQSvK53V9wNv51sOf6RAtdnqAqny6RlCAU 13837
rocketpy/stochastic/stochastic_environment.py sha256=ReEdUe6GYajzkwBwqQFDLAFDckJO8tofZfK37ySLuqo 7483
rocketpy/stochastic/stochastic_flight.py sha256=pIteeNB-_xNalkScjgz_97Ii1LiXB48J-3tV91wTjr0 4930
rocketpy/stochastic/stochastic_generic_motor.py sha256=0NZFkaqsJG8EpTZvF9Rqr7ZJLMihL4I75O5Ab2xX11I 8105
rocketpy/stochastic/stochastic_model.py sha256=uLJGVDFXfUrdpgLvfHt0DEPKzbcplMI3dBJMb7r715k 18734
rocketpy/stochastic/stochastic_motor_model.py sha256=jpEum44jG7J3PARwfoJEFMRpGsRDIWtQVp6lvSC-hP8 640
rocketpy/stochastic/stochastic_parachute.py sha256=SJyhx8JtpV1r76-m3tNRMP2EeYLHt2LD1c26nS5Yjgk 4035
rocketpy/stochastic/stochastic_rocket.py sha256=G0NPu8QVtr90xhUBXdGaPmsJhT-M_qp4yjAwBHMI7sQ 23237
rocketpy/stochastic/stochastic_solid_motor.py sha256=UxldcYdKO_GduDRU8bHzyar5-e1f7hOt5CNGt2PLOHs 9844
rocketpy-1.6.1.dist-info/LICENSE sha256=yW57cdzzKVxFFK-hmx40XzI86tgd3DNmluc5e4GTShM 1079
rocketpy-1.6.1.dist-info/METADATA sha256=EW_qCKd3w_eAfc79RzHf4rFbibahXRhp2AvBIH3tnas 17945
rocketpy-1.6.1.dist-info/WHEEL sha256=GV9aMThwP_4oNCtvEC2ec3qUYutgWeAzklro_0m4WJQ 91
rocketpy-1.6.1.dist-info/top_level.txt sha256=RnNaRRe3dIPwwuaamN5QLOgTRBe3nI84kiOvspb0wQE 9
rocketpy-1.6.1.dist-info/RECORD

top_level.txt

rocketpy